Housing
Type of housing: On campus
Arranged by: Host university
If returning, I would choose: On campus
Why?
It is so much more convienient to live on campus. it is also much easier to get to know the french students and to participate in campus activities!
Read more >
Personal comments
The rooms were very small for two people. The furniture and the bathroom were in very good condition (every room had its own bathroom). The rooms didn't cost very much(350 francs per person) which is about the amount that I recieved from the Erasmus- programm.
